Beyond physical skills, the ability to maintain focus, resilience, and confidence in high-pressure situations is key to success in this competitive cricket league. Whether it’s dealing with a winning streak or bouncing back from a defeat, the mental fortitude of players can greatly impact the outcome of matches.

In the fast-paced world of IPL cricket, teams that prioritize mental preparation have a significant advantage over their competitors. By incorporating strategies such as visualization, goal-setting, and mindfulness techniques into their training routines, players can enhance their overall performance and stay mentally sharp throughout the demanding tournament. Cultivating a positive mindset and developing mental resilience are essential elements for teams aiming to secure victories and maintain peak performance levels in the high-stakes environment of the IPL.

Understanding the Psychological Challenges Faced by IPL Players

IPL players face a myriad of psychological challenges as they step out onto the field. The immense pressure to perform in front of the world, the expectations of fans and team owners, and the fear of failure can all weigh heavily on their minds. The constant scrutiny and analysis from media and critics can further add to the mental strain these players endure.

Additionally, the demanding schedule of the IPL, with back-to-back matches and frequent travel, can take a toll on the mental well-being of the players. The lack of time for rest and recovery, coupled with the need to constantly adapt to different playing conditions and opponents, can lead to heightened stress levels and fatigue. Managing these challenges effectively is crucial for players to maintain their focus and perform at their best throughout the tournament.
